HTML5绘制的机器猫动画
编辑:本站更新:2024-10-12 13:55:09人气:1518
在现代网页设计与开发领域中,HTML5技术以其强大的兼容性、灵活性和丰富的多媒体支持能力成为创新实践的重要工具。其中一个生动且引人入胜的例子便是利用HTML5绘制出栩栩如生的机器猫(Doraemon)动画。
HTML5作为一种超文本标记语言的标准版,在其canvas元素的支持下能够实现高性能图形处理及动态渲染功能。开发者通过JavaScript编程接口操纵canvas画布,可以逐帧描绘并播放复杂的2D或3D图像序列,从而生成流畅而细腻的动画效果。
以广受欢迎的经典动漫角色——机器猫为例,使用HTML5 canvas创建它的动画场景时,首先需要精细地拆解每一个动作到最小单位:眨眼、挥手、飞行甚至掏出神奇道具等,并将这些动作转化为一系列静态图片或者关键点数据;随后运用requestAnimationFrame API来控制每一帧画面更新的时间间隔以及顺序切换不同状态下的图层内容。
为了增加真实感和互动体验,还可以结合CSS3对视觉样式进行丰富和完善,例如添加阴影、渐变色、旋转和平移动效等等。同时借助WebSocket或其他实时通信手段,则可以让用户参与到这个由代码构建起来的世界里,操控机器猫的动作甚至是触发特定剧情发展。
此外,HTML5还提供了音频和视频标签,使得为这一系列精美的机器猫动画配上原汁原味的声音对话或是背景音乐变得轻而易举,极大地提升了整体作品的表现力和沉浸式用户体验。
总的来说,基于HTML5所创作出来的机器猫动画不仅展现了该标准对于富媒体应用的强大承载能力和表现张力,更预示着未来Web应用程序将在交互性和娱乐化方面有着更为广阔的发展空间。这不仅是技术创新的一次有力展示,更是向经典致敬的独特方式,让一代代人的童年记忆在网络世界焕发新生,持续传递欢乐与梦想的力量。
HTML5作为一种超文本标记语言的标准版,在其canvas元素的支持下能够实现高性能图形处理及动态渲染功能。开发者通过JavaScript编程接口操纵canvas画布,可以逐帧描绘并播放复杂的2D或3D图像序列,从而生成流畅而细腻的动画效果。
以广受欢迎的经典动漫角色——机器猫为例,使用HTML5 canvas创建它的动画场景时,首先需要精细地拆解每一个动作到最小单位:眨眼、挥手、飞行甚至掏出神奇道具等,并将这些动作转化为一系列静态图片或者关键点数据;随后运用requestAnimationFrame API来控制每一帧画面更新的时间间隔以及顺序切换不同状态下的图层内容。
为了增加真实感和互动体验,还可以结合CSS3对视觉样式进行丰富和完善,例如添加阴影、渐变色、旋转和平移动效等等。同时借助WebSocket或其他实时通信手段,则可以让用户参与到这个由代码构建起来的世界里,操控机器猫的动作甚至是触发特定剧情发展。
此外,HTML5还提供了音频和视频标签,使得为这一系列精美的机器猫动画配上原汁原味的声音对话或是背景音乐变得轻而易举,极大地提升了整体作品的表现力和沉浸式用户体验。
总的来说,基于HTML5所创作出来的机器猫动画不仅展现了该标准对于富媒体应用的强大承载能力和表现张力,更预示着未来Web应用程序将在交互性和娱乐化方面有着更为广阔的发展空间。这不仅是技术创新的一次有力展示,更是向经典致敬的独特方式,让一代代人的童年记忆在网络世界焕发新生,持续传递欢乐与梦想的力量。
www.php580.com PHP工作室 - 全面的PHP教程、实例、框架与实战资源
PHP学习网是专注于PHP技术学习的一站式在线平台,提供丰富全面的PHP教程、深入浅出的实例解析、主流PHP框架详解及实战应用,并涵盖PHP面试指南、最新资讯和活跃的PHP开发者社区。无论您是初学者还是进阶者,这里都有助于提升您的PHP编程技能。
转载内容版权归作者及来源网站所有,本站原创内容转载请注明来源。